Which airlines are in SMF Terminal A?
Sacramento Airport’s Terminal A is served by Air Canada, American, United and Delta Airlines.

Does SMF have TSA pre-clearance?
TSA has offered TSA Pre✓® at SMF since 2014. As always, TSA continues to embed random and unpredictable, visible and invisible, security measures throughout the airport. All travelers will be screened and no individual will be guaranteed expedited screening. To learn more about TSA Pre✓®, visit tsa.gov/precheck.

Which airlines fly to Sacramento Airport?
Sacramento Airport’s Terminal B is served by Aeromexico, Alaska, Contour, Frontier, Hawaiian, Horizon, Jet Blue, Southwest, Spirit, Sun Country and Volaris. Passengers can move between terminals with a free airport shuttle.

Where are the departure gates at Sacramento Airport?
Sacramento Airport’s Terminal A hosts gates A1 through A5 and A10 through A17 located on the upper level. It is served by the following carriers: Air Canada, American, United and Delta Airlines. Terminal B. Sacramento Airport’s Terminal B hosts gates B4 through B12 and B14 through B23.
